Procedures for NCSU Students to take Courses Elsewhere for Credit-Transfer back to NCSU
Prior approval required
Each year a few students in our Mathematics curricula take courses at other institutions for the purpose of obtaining transfer credits which satisfy degree requirements at NCSU. Summer session courses are frequently used for this purpose.
The Advisers' Handbook specifies that such students must "make prior arrangements with their deans to insure receiving credit for the work done." The granting of such transfer credit involves evaluation in terms of "equivalent" courses at NCSU. In order to minimize difficulties and misunderstanding, there is a uniform request form (and procedure) which will be used by the Mathematics Department. A copy of the request form is available in HA 255 or you may download the Equivalency Form.
The courses most readily approved for such transfer credit are those which can be used in the humanities/social sciences category. Courses to satisfy specific curriculum course requirements and courses for use as mathematics electives, or technical electives in either the MA or AMA programs should be scheduled here on the NC State campus (except under very special circumstances).
To submit such a request, a student should obtain specific information concerning the desired course(s) at the other institution (course number, title, catalog description, etc.) and then consult with his/her adviser or the Scheduling Officer
Proceedures After Taking the Courses
1. Have an official copy of your transcript sent directly to NC State's Registration and Records
2. Check for mistakes. After the transcript has been processed, the courses will appear on your ADA.
3. If one or more courses are incorrectly or incompletely listed, then you should collect course materials (e.g. syllabus and final exam), and contact the Math Department's Scheduling Officer.
